What will happen next?
Integration planning meetings will begin after regulatory applications have been filed, so stay tuned for additional information as that process starts.
It will take time for the approval process to be completed. Over the past six years, OceanFirst has completed seven whole bank acquisitions, with the majority of the employees of acquired banks being offered positions to stay at OceanFirst after the acquisition. The OceanFirst team of more than 1,000 employees includes hundreds of employees who joined our family after the acquisition of the bank who was their former employer, so many of our employees have first-hand understanding of the challenges that go along with an acquisition. We also understand that every bank is unique and, therefore, each integration is always a little different. However, with each acquisition we have learned more and enhanced our best practices related to both employees and customers during the many stages of the approval and integration process. Throughout the process and any transition, we know all employees will collaborate and be responsive and respectful of customers and co-workers. As we continue to work together, timelines may be modified, and we will share this information as soon as possible.
